Ingredients

List of Ingredients

To make Pumpkin Cream Cheese Stuffed French Toast, gather these items:

– 8 slices of thick-cut bread (like brioche or challah)

– 1 cup pumpkin puree

– 8 oz cream cheese, softened

– 1/4 cup brown sugar

– 1 tsp vanilla extract

– 1 tsp pumpkin pie spice

– 4 large eggs

– 1 cup milk

– 1 tsp cinnamon

– 1/4 tsp nutmeg

– 1 tbsp butter for frying

– Maple syrup for serving

– Powdered sugar for garnish

Recommended Bread Types

Choosing the right bread makes a big difference. The best types are:

– Brioche: Soft and rich, it absorbs flavors well.

– Challah: Slightly sweet and fluffy, perfect for French toast.

– French bread: Offers a nice crust and can hold the filling.

– Texas toast: Thick and sturdy, great for stuffing.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paring the Pumpkin Cream Cheese Mixture

Start by grabbing a large mixing bowl. Add one cup of pumpkin puree. Next, include eight ounces of softened cream cheese. It should be nice and soft for easy mixing. Then, mix in a quarter cup of brown sugar. This adds sweetness to our filling. Don’t forget a teaspoon of vanilla extract for flavor. Finally, add a teaspoon of pumpkin pie spice. This spice brings a warm, cozy flavor. Mix everything until smooth and creamy.

Assembling the French Toast Sandwiches

Take four slices of thick-cut bread, like brioche or challah. Spread a generous layer of your pumpkin cream cheese mixture on each slice. Make sure to cover the bread well. Now, take the remaining four slices and place them on top. Press down gently to form sandwiches. This step is key to holding all that delicious filling inside.

Cooking Techniques for Perfect French Toast

In a bowl, whisk together four large eggs, one cup of milk, one teaspoon of cinnamon, and a quarter teaspoon of nutmeg. This mix will coat our sandwiches. Heat a skillet or griddle over medium heat. Add a tablespoon of butter until it melts. Dip each sandwich into the egg mixture, coating both sides. Let the excess mixture drip off. Place the sandwiches on the skillet and cook for about three to four minutes per side. Look for a golden brown color. Adjust the heat if they start to burn. Once cooked, keep them warm while you finish the rest. Serve warm with maple syrup and a dusting of powdered sugar for a sweet touch.

Tips & Tricks

How to Achieve the Best Flavor

To make your Pumpkin Cream Cheese Stuffed French Toast shine, use fresh ingredients. Choose ripe pumpkin puree for a deep flavor. I love adding a pinch of salt to the cream cheese mixture. It helps balance the sweetness. Also, let the cream cheese soften enough. This makes it easier to blend with the pumpkin.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

One common mistake is using stale bread. Fresh, thick-cut bread works best. If your bread is too thin, it may fall apart. Another mistake is not cooking over medium heat. Too high heat can burn the outside while the inside stays raw. Also, don’t skip letting excess egg mixture drip off. This helps prevent soggy French toast.

Ways to Customize Your Recipe

You can easily customize this recipe to fit your taste. Try adding chocolate chips to the cream cheese filling for a sweet twist. If you like nuts, mix in some chopped pecans or walnuts. For a spicier kick, add more pumpkin pie spice or a dash of cayenne. You can even swap out the maple syrup for honey or agave syrup.

Storage Info

Refrigeration Guidelines

After making your Pumpkin Cream Cheese Stuffed French Toast, let it cool. Place the leftover slices in an airtight container. Keep it in the fridge for up to three days. This keeps the flavors fresh and tasty. When you’re ready to eat, you can enjoy it warm again.

Freezing Instructions

To freeze your stuffed French toast, first, let it cool completely. Then, wrap each slice tightly in plastic wrap. Place wrapped slices in a freezer-safe bag. They can last up to two months in the freezer. This is a great way to save leftovers for later.

Reheating Tips

When you want to reheat, you have a few options. For the best results, use the oven. Preheat it to 350°F (175°C). Place the toast on a baking sheet for about 10-15 minutes. If using a microwave, heat each slice for about 30 seconds. Check if it’s warm enough. Enjoy your tasty dish just like fresh!

FAQs

Can I make this recipe 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the pumpkin cream cheese mix a day before. Store it in the fridge. You can also assemble the sandwiches ahead of time. Just keep them in the fridge until you are ready to cook. This can save you time in the morning.

What can I serve with Pumpkin Cream Cheese Stuffed French Toast?

You can serve this dish with many tasty sides. Here are some ideas:

– Fresh fruit like bananas, berries, or apples

– Crispy bacon or sausage links

– Yogurt for a creamy side

– Whipped cream for added sweetness

– A sprinkle of chopped nuts for crunch

These items add flavor and color to your plate.

How do I know when the French toast is fully cooked?

Look for a golden-brown color on each side. You can gently press down on the toast. If it feels firm and springs back, it is ready. If you cut into it, the inside should feel warm and soft. Make sure the cream cheese is heated through, too.
